This is a BR Class 360/2, you have seen the Thai one, now for a weirder version. This is the variant once used by Heathrow Connect, with one train, 360205, being used for Heathrow Express!

These trains, 5 in total, were also the victim of poor rollingstock management. While some of Britain still had 40 year old trains, 360204 and 360205 were dismantled at a scrapyard! Perfectly good trains trashed, as a symbol of British Rail's disconnection!
